Hallo zusammen,
ich befeuere einen Asterisk (11.13.1, Standard-Paket unter Debian 8.2) bei mir mit "Callfiles", um einige Personen über Monitoringevents durch automatische Anrufe zu informieren (so schön mit Ansagen "es gibt xy neue Alarme" etc.). Am Ende kommt dann ein Text "Drück die Taste "X" um dies zu Quittieren". So sehe ich, ob die Nachricht wirklich abgehört wurde oder ob evtl. nur ein Anrufbeantworter dran war und bei dem Kollege "von Hand" nachgefragt werden muss.
Was ich nun noch gern schauen würde ist, ob der Anruf abgewiesen wurde (mit einem Handy "weggedrückt") bzw. ob es einfach nur "ewig geklingelt hat". Abgewiesene Anrufe könnte ich so nämlich auch tracken als "erreicht".
Ich hab gestern den ganzen Tag gegoogelt, aber dazu nichts gefunden. evtl. kann mir ja jemand von euch da weiterhelfen.
In den Logs steht nämlich stets nur ein "Call failed to go through, reason (3) Remote end Ringing". Ich kann also nicht zwischen "nicht ran gegangen" und "weggedrückt" unterscheiden.
Kennt jemand eine Möglichkeit, dies abzufangen/zu erkennen?
Was mir auffiel ist, dass die Meldung in den Logs auftaucht wenn es am Telefon nicht mehr klingelt (klar). Da ich das auf 30 Sekunden eingestellt habe, also nach 30 Sekunden.
Drücke ich einen Anruf nach 2 mal Klingeln (5-10 Sekunden) weg, taucht der Eintrag in den Logs aber auch erst nach 30 Sekunden auf...
Viele Grüße,
xypseudo
ich befeuere einen Asterisk (11.13.1, Standard-Paket unter Debian 8.2) bei mir mit "Callfiles", um einige Personen über Monitoringevents durch automatische Anrufe zu informieren (so schön mit Ansagen "es gibt xy neue Alarme" etc.). Am Ende kommt dann ein Text "Drück die Taste "X" um dies zu Quittieren". So sehe ich, ob die Nachricht wirklich abgehört wurde oder ob evtl. nur ein Anrufbeantworter dran war und bei dem Kollege "von Hand" nachgefragt werden muss.
Was ich nun noch gern schauen würde ist, ob der Anruf abgewiesen wurde (mit einem Handy "weggedrückt") bzw. ob es einfach nur "ewig geklingelt hat". Abgewiesene Anrufe könnte ich so nämlich auch tracken als "erreicht".
Ich hab gestern den ganzen Tag gegoogelt, aber dazu nichts gefunden. evtl. kann mir ja jemand von euch da weiterhelfen.
In den Logs steht nämlich stets nur ein "Call failed to go through, reason (3) Remote end Ringing". Ich kann also nicht zwischen "nicht ran gegangen" und "weggedrückt" unterscheiden.
Kennt jemand eine Möglichkeit, dies abzufangen/zu erkennen?
Was mir auffiel ist, dass die Meldung in den Logs auftaucht wenn es am Telefon nicht mehr klingelt (klar). Da ich das auf 30 Sekunden eingestellt habe, also nach 30 Sekunden.
Drücke ich einen Anruf nach 2 mal Klingeln (5-10 Sekunden) weg, taucht der Eintrag in den Logs aber auch erst nach 30 Sekunden auf...
Viele Grüße,
xypseudo